WebThe Bank Secrecy Act of 1970 (BSA), also known as the Currency and Foreign Transactions Reporting Act, is a U.S. law requiring financial institutions in the United States to assist U.S. government agencies in detecting and preventing money laundering. WebFlorida's banking law is contained within Title 38 of Florida Statutes. This title regulates commercial banks, credit unions, and trust companies. The full text of this title is available here. Blue sky laws. Blue sky laws regulate the sale of securities. Blue sky laws are enacted at the state level and are enforced by state regulatory agencies.
